计算机网络
文章平均质量分 62
Xiang-Gen
编程中最没用的东西是源代码,最有用的东西是算法和数据结构。
展开
-
Websocket协议
简介 HHML5后引入的规范。Websocket协议是一种双向通信协议,与HTTP协议一样都是基于TCP。 HTTP协议是半双工的(独木桥),请求结束就会断开;WebSocket是全双工的通信协议(电话),只有在客户端或者服务器任意一端断开连接才会断开原创 2016-07-22 14:31:12 · 252 阅读 · 0 评论 -
HTTP
基本概念简介 HTTP即超文本传输协议(Hyper Text Transfer Protocol)原创 2016-07-27 17:30:14 · 505 阅读 · 0 评论 -
路由器和交换机区别
路由器交换机总结 路由器工作于OSI模型的网络层,能够识别IP地址,并根据IP地址转发数据包,并维护着路由表,能够基于路由表进行最佳路线选择。 此外,路由器上还能开启ACL访问控制列表、NAT地址转换等功能,扩展网络应用。 传统交换机工作于OSI模型的数据链路层,能够识别MAC地址,根据MAC地址转发数据帧,并维护着一张桥表,根据桥表上MAC地址和端口的对应关系进行数据帧转发。原创 2016-08-10 16:23:22 · 345 阅读 · 0 评论 -
Ping及ICMP协议
Ping度娘解释: Ping是Windows、Unix和Linux系统下的一个命令。ping也属于一个通信协议,是TCP/IP协议的一部分。利用“ping”命令可以检查网络是否连通,可以很好地帮助我们分析和判定网络故障。 PING (Packet Internet Groper),因特网包探索器,用于测试网络连接量的程序。Ping发送一个ICMP(Internet Control Me转载 2016-08-10 15:47:03 · 7839 阅读 · 0 评论 -
IP详解
基本概念 IP(Internet Protocol):网络互连协议。IP地址是一个32位的二进制数,采用点分十进制表示 IP报文结构 普通IP报文头部长度为20个字节。 版本:标明IP协议的版本,目前为IPV4为4;报文长度:指IP包头部长度,占四位。总长度:整个IP数据包的长度。 服务类型:TOC,Type of Service。8位(3位COS+4原创 2016-08-10 20:24:23 · 7322 阅读 · 0 评论 -
HTTP与HTTPS的区别
HTTPHTTPS原创 2016-07-27 00:00:31 · 310 阅读 · 0 评论 -
TCP/UDP
基本概念 TCP(Transmission Control Protocol):传输控制协议,在网络OSI的七层模型中的第四层——传输层 UDP(User Datagram Protocol):用户数据报协议。无连接的传输层协议。 TCP提供IP环境下的数据可靠传输,它提供的服务包括数据流传送、超时重传、有效流控、全双工操作和多路复用。通过面向连接、端到端和可靠的数据包发原创 2016-08-09 20:13:30 · 299 阅读 · 0 评论 -
OSI七层模型 vs TCP/IP五层模型
概述 Open System Interconnect,即开放式系统互联,一般叫做OSI参考模型。该模型定义了网络互连的七层框架(物理层、数据链路层、网络层、传输层、会话层、表示层和应用层) 总结 各层的结构和功能原创 2016-08-09 17:39:38 · 599 阅读 · 0 评论 -
Session与Cookie的区别
这个是面试时经常问及的知识点,作为Java Web开发人员,这两个概念需要特别清楚原创 2016-07-26 23:14:12 · 325 阅读 · 0 评论 -
协议森林
关于网络,有一个系列博文“协议森林”讲的特别好,这里转载加以学习: http://www.cnblogs.com/vamei/archive/2012/12/05/2802811.html转载 2016-08-15 15:19:58 · 551 阅读 · 0 评论 -
Java socket
知识储备模型通信模型主要是基于CS结构。通信一方作为服务器(Server)先运行(一般作为守护进程始终运行)、监听端口、并等待客户端提出请求。难点:通信双方建立连接;通信双方进行可靠高效数据传输(TCP/UDP)。在TCP/IP 协议中,IP层负责网络主机定位,TCP提供面向应用的可靠(tcp)的或非可靠(udp)的数据传输机制。 引在Java环境下,Socket编程主要是指基于TCP/IP协原创 2016-07-13 17:01:32 · 425 阅读 · 0 评论 -
浏览器地址栏输入URL,回车......
问题解析 这是一道经典的面试题目,考察对网络知识的了解程度,回答必须到点上!参考解答 在任意浏览器端输入URL(Uniform Resource Locator,统一资源定位符,区别URI)地址,敲下回车键。 URL格式:如http://10.18.34.113:8080/scms 包括协议(http)、网络地址(10.18.34.113:8080)、资源路径(/scms )三个部分原创 2016-08-10 14:46:09 · 768 阅读 · 0 评论